Factors That Affect the Profitability Of A Business

1. Market Demand and Competition:

  • Market Demand: The profitability of a business is significantly influenced by the demand for its products or services in the market. High demand can lead to increased sales and revenue, contributing to profitability. However, market demand can be affected by various factors like consumer preferences, economic conditions, and trends, making it crucial for businesses to adapt and meet the changing needs of their target market.
  • Competition: The level of competition in the market also impacts profitability. In a highly competitive market, businesses may need to reduce prices, increase marketing efforts, or enhance product features to maintain or grow their market share, which can affect profit margins. Conversely, in markets with less competition, a business might have more pricing power and potentially higher profitability.

2. Expertise:

Having a strong knowledge base in your business area is very beneficial. Practical experience is valuable, but you can also enhance your understanding of a particular business field through various courses and educational programs.

3. Access to Skilled Workers:

The success of your business heavily depends on your employees. Choosing skilled and talented workers can bring lasting benefits to your company. Therefore, being able to identify and hire skilled workers is essential.

4. Location:

The right location can significantly influence your business’s success. For instance, the best agricultural businesses in India are often found in regions where farming is the main economic activity. Choosing a business that fits well with the location is important to leverage local advantages.

4 Reasons Why Entrepreneurs Fail Even With Profitable Business Niches

1. Lack of Market Research and Business Planning:

Entrepreneurs often fail when they do not adequately research the market or plan their business strategies. Even in profitable niches, success requires understanding market needs, customer behavior, and competitive dynamics. Failure to conduct comprehensive market research and develop a solid business plan can lead to poor decision-making and strategic missteps.

2. Inadequate Financial Management:

Profitable niches can still lead to business failure if financial resources are not managed wisely. Poor cash flow management, ineffective cost control, and insufficient capital can hinder a business’s ability to operate effectively, invest in growth opportunities, or survive economic downturns.

3. Failure to Innovate and Adapt:

Markets are dynamic, and what is profitable today may not be tomorrow. Entrepreneurs who fail to innovate and adapt to technological advances, market trends, or regulatory changes can find their businesses struggling. Staying competitive in profitable niches often requires continuous improvement and innovation.

4. Ineffective Marketing and Branding:

Even in a profitable niche, businesses need effective marketing and branding strategies to stand out and attract customers. Poor marketing efforts, unclear branding, or failure to communicate value propositions can result in lost sales opportunities and reduced profitability.

5. Operational Inefficiencies:

Operational inefficiencies can erode profit margins, leading to business failure. This includes issues like poor supply chain management, suboptimal production processes, or inadequate human resource management. Businesses need to continually seek efficiency improvements to sustain profitability.

6. Underestimating the Competition:

Entrepreneurs may fail in profitable niches by underestimating the intensity of competition. New entrants or established players can intensify competition, leading to price wars, increased customer acquisition costs, or the need for rapid innovation, which can strain resources and reduce profitability.

21. Pet Business:

The pet retailing business in India is becoming increasingly profitable due to the rising pet ownership and the humanization of pets. As people treat their pets as family members, there is a growing demand for high-quality pet products and services, including food, toys, grooming, and healthcare. The market has expanded to include specialty products like organic pet food, designer clothes, and luxury accessories. Additionally, services such as pet boarding, training, and daycare are in demand.
The emotional bond between pet owners and their pets drives consumer spending in this sector, making it a lucrative market. With the rise of e-commerce, online pet stores have also become popular, offering convenience and a wide range of products, further boosting the profitability of the pet retailing business.

22. Car Retailing Business:

The car retailing business in India remains highly profitable, driven by the growing middle class and increasing disposable incomes. The market’s diversity, offering a range of vehicles from budget to luxury cars, caters to various consumer segments. Factors contributing to its profitability include the expanding urban population, improved road infrastructure, and the aspirational value associated with car ownership. Car dealerships not only profit from selling new and used cars but also from after-sales services, financing, and insurance. The rise of electric vehicles (EVs) and environmentally friendly technologies has opened new avenues for growth in the car retailing sector. Additionally, digital platforms and online showrooms have enhanced the car buying experience, attracting more customers and facilitating sales. The competitive landscape encourages dealerships to innovate in customer service, financing options, and marketing strategies, further enhancing profitability in the car retailing business.

FAQs:

1. What are the Options for Funding a Business in India?

In India, financing a business can be achieved through various means, including personal investment, bootstrapping, securing funds from angel investors, venture capital, obtaining bank loans, and leveraging government schemes. Selecting an appropriate funding method should be based on the specific needs of your business, your willingness to assume risk, and the level of investment needed.

2. What is the Timeframe for Establishing a Business in India?

The duration required to establish a business in India varies based on the business category and the associated legal formalities. Generally, the process can range from a few weeks to several months. To expedite this process, it’s crucial to have all necessary documentation prepared and comply with legal requirements promptly.

3. Is it Possible for Non-Indians to Start a Business in India?

Foreign nationals are permitted to start businesses in India, adhering to the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) policy. There are specific limitations and rules to follow, and compliance with the Foreign Exchange Management Act (FEMA) and other relevant legal stipulations is mandatory.
